Philadelphia witnessed a devastating plane crash today involving a Learjet 55, which went down near Roosevelt Mall in Northeast Philadelphia. The medical jet was reportedly en route to pick up a pediatric patient when it crashed, sparking immediate emergency response efforts. This tragic Philadelphia plane crash 2025 has left the city in shock, raising concerns about air ambulance safety and aviation incidents in Pennsylvania.
What Happened?
At approximately 9:45 PM on January 31, 2025 the Learjet 55 operated by Jet Rescue Air Ambulance crashed near Cottman Avenue, close to Roosevelt Mall. Reports indicate that the aircraft, identified as XA-UCI, was attempting to land at Northeast Philadelphia Airport when it suddenly lost altitude and crashed. Witnesses described hearing a loud explosion before seeing flames and smoke billowing from the wreckage.
Emergency crews from the Philadelphia Fire Department and local law enforcement arrived at the scene within minutes. Firefighters worked tirelessly to extinguish the blaze while medical personnel searched for survivors.
Fatalities and Injuries
While official reports are still being verified, preliminary information suggests that all four people on board the medical transport plane lost their lives. The victims include two pilots, a flight nurse, and a paramedic. Fortunately no civilians on the ground were harmed, but several bystanders were treated for shock and minor injuries caused by flying debris.
Possible Causes of the Crash
Aviation experts and the National Transportation Safety Board (NTSB) have launched an investigation into the Philadelphia plane crash. Several factors are being considered:
- Mechanical Failure: Early reports suggest the Learjet 55 may have experienced engine failure just before the crash.
- Weather Conditions: Although the skies were clear, strong winds may have played a role in the aircraft’s descent.
- Pilot Error: Investigators will review the flight logs and cockpit voice recordings to determine if human error contributed to the accident.

The Learjet 55: A Look at the Aircraft
The Learjet 55 is a twin-engine business jet commonly used for medical transport and corporate travel. Known for its speed and reliability, it has been in operation for decades. However, aging aircraft models like this one have faced increased mechanical issues, leading to concerns about their safety.
